Meet Our 𝘳𝘦𝘤𝘦𝘴𝘴 Workshop Instructor: Produce Section & Day Off Studios Produce Section is an artist collective with a passion for hosting and a deep love for sharing food with friends, both new and familiar. Through thoughtfully curated dining experiences, they foster community by bringing people together around the table. In a world driven by instant gratification, Produce Section invites guests to slow down, savor the moment, and engage fully. For them, the creation of the meal is just as meaningful as the act of eating itself. Day Off is a slow textile craft club rooted in care, creativity, and community. Members gather to stitch, share, and reclaim time—welcoming both newcomers and experienced makers. Their mission is to cultivate a soft, welcoming space that centers Black and Brown makers while holding room for anyone who approaches with care and respect.    Date: January 22nd Time: 6:00 PM – 9:00 PM             Location: Playground: 1114 Bedford Ave, Brooklyn, NY 11216             Cost: $30, $40, $45 Capacity: 15                Edible Bouquets: The Alchemy of Preservation Building on our edible bouquet workshops in collaboration with Day Off Studios, this session explores ingredient preservation and kitchen alchemy as a form of decoration. For this installment, we’ll work with herbs and edible elements such as orange peels, star anise, and other aromatics that can be naturally dried and preserved. These materials can later be used in kitchen rituals, adding both beauty and function to your space. As the colder months set in, restoration and preservation take center stage. This workshop encourages participants to reconnect with time-honored, ancestral methods of nourishment, mindful use, and reducing food waste. All materials will be provided to create your own preserved edible arrangement.
